F(x) = 28 + 10x²; solve for f(1) and f(27)

Mathematics
1 answer:
Natasha2012 [34]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

f(x) = 28 + 10x²

For f(1) substitute 1 into f(x)

That's

f(1) = 28 + 10(1)²

= 28 + 10

<h3>= 38</h3>

f(27) = 28 + 10(27)²

= 28 + 7290

<h3>= 7318</h3>
